Donald Trump Approval Rating Update: Support Hits Highest Level in Months

  • The Rasmussen Reports presidential tracking poll on June 4, 2025, showed 51% of likely U.S. voters approved of President Trump's job performance.
  • This rating follows an upward trend from several polls in May and early June after a low net approval rating near-9 points on April 28, 2025.
  • Additional polls from Trafalgar Group and Daily Mail/J.L. Partners recorded approval ratings between 50% and 54%, with Rasmussen showing a consistent 52% approval over consecutive days.
  • Rasmussen's June 2 tracker reported 53% approval, close to inauguration week figures, while Trafalgar's May 30–June 1 poll showed 54% approval and a net positive rating of +8.
  • These poll results indicate stable or slightly improving approval for Trump’s presidency amid recent political developments, but ratings may continue fluctuating in coming weeks.
